  3. 1. countable noun. A potty is a deep bowl which a small child uses instead of a toilet. 2. graded adjective [usually verb-link ADJECTIVE] If you say that someone is potty, you think that their behaviour is very strange or foolish. [British, informal, disapproval] More Synonyms of potty. Collins COBUILD Advanced Learner’s Dictionary.
